package engine import ( "context" "errors" "testing" "time" "tangled.org/core/spindle/models" ) func TestSemaphoreSlotterDisabledDoesNotBlock(t *testing.T) { t.Parallel() slotter := NewSemaphoreSlotter(0) for range 10 { slot, err := slotter.AcquireWorkflowSlot(context.Background(), zeroWorkflowID(), nil) if err != nil { t.Fatalf("AcquireWorkflowSlot() error = %v", err) } slot.Release() } } func TestSemaphoreSlotterBlocksUntilRelease(t *testing.T) { t.Parallel() slotter := NewSemaphoreSlotter(1) first, err := slotter.AcquireWorkflowSlot(context.Background(), zeroWorkflowID(), nil) if err != nil { t.Fatalf("first AcquireWorkflowSlot() error = %v", err) } releasedFirst := false defer func() { if !releasedFirst { first.Release() } }() acquired := make(chan WorkflowSlot, 1) errs := make(chan error, 1) go func() { slot, err := slotter.AcquireWorkflowSlot(context.Background(), zeroWorkflowID(), nil) if err != nil { errs <- err return } acquired <- slot }() assertNotAcquired(t, acquired, errs) first.Release() releasedFirst = true second := waitForSlot(t, acquired, errs) second.Release() } func TestSemaphoreSlotterHonorsContextCancellation(t *testing.T) { t.Parallel() slotter := NewSemaphoreSlotter(1) first, err := slotter.AcquireWorkflowSlot(context.Background(), zeroWorkflowID(), nil) if err != nil { t.Fatalf("first AcquireWorkflowSlot() error = %v", err) } defer first.Release() ctx, cancel := context.WithCancel(context.Background()) cancel() _, err = slotter.AcquireWorkflowSlot(ctx, zeroWorkflowID(), nil) if !errors.Is(err, context.Canceled) { t.Fatalf("AcquireWorkflowSlot() error = %v, want context.Canceled", err) } } func assertNotAcquired(t *testing.T, acquired <-chan WorkflowSlot, errs <-chan error) { t.Helper() select { case slot := <-acquired: slot.Release() t.Fatal("AcquireWorkflowSlot() acquired a slot before one was released") case err := <-errs: t.Fatalf("AcquireWorkflowSlot() returned unexpected error: %v", err) case <-time.After(25 * time.Millisecond): } } func waitForSlot(t *testing.T, acquired <-chan WorkflowSlot, errs <-chan error) WorkflowSlot { t.Helper() select { case slot := <-acquired: return slot case err := <-errs: t.Fatalf("AcquireWorkflowSlot() returned error: %v", err) case <-time.After(time.Second): t.Fatal("timed out waiting for slot acquisition") } return nil } func zeroWorkflowID() models.WorkflowId { return models.WorkflowId{} }
